'''Stephen Leeds''' was an American on Earth.
He was a highly intelligent person, but was unable to function at such a level. His brain created [[Aspect]]s, which were compartments of his brain as hallucinations. Only he can see them, and each is an expert on one, or possibly multiple, topics. The medical community, uncertain what to think of him, label him a schizophrenic. Many psychologists have tried to analyze and write papers about him. In Legion:Skin Deep, the writer for a tabloid sends someone with a sound recorder on a blind date with him. Stephen uses his abilities to solve cases as a private detective. He calls himself a specialist- one who specializes in many different areas. In Legion:Skin Deep, he is offered a job that will allow him complete financial independence, so that he no longer needs to take cases. Though he had not wanted to take the job previously, this gave him pause, showing that he does not enjoy this profession.
